Book: Waking Up To Boys
My Summer To-Do List:

Practice wakeboard front flip

Host late-night island party

Build a bonfire

Seduce Todd

Chelsea's more comfortable strapped onto her wakeboard on Lake Tahoe than laced into platform espadrilles-- or flirting with Todd, the adorable watersports instructor she's been crushing on for years. So instead she concentrates on winning this summer's Northwest Extreme Watersports Competition. That is, until Sebastian, a hot Brazilian tennis prodigy, wakes her up to the fact that she can get a boy. But can she get the one she really wants, even if she's competing against him for the gold?
